Understanding Return-to-Player Information

Return to player, commonly shown as RTP, represents the theoretical percentage a game returns over a very large number of rounds. It is not a promise for a particular session. Volatility is equally relevant: high-volatility games can produce larger but less frequent wins, while lower-volatility titles often deliver smaller outcomes more regularly. Neither measure guarantees a result, but both provide useful context.

Bonuses Need Careful Reading

Promotions can increase entertainment value, yet the headline amount is only one part of the offer. Examine the required deposit, wagering multiplier, game contribution rules, maximum qualifying stake, expiry period, and any withdrawal cap. Some bonuses apply only to selected games, while free spins may be limited to a particular slot or released over several days.

  • Confirm whether the offer is available to new or existing customers.
  • Check the exact wagering calculation and eligible deposits.
  • Review the maximum bet allowed during playthrough.
  • Look for expiry dates and restricted games.
  • Understand how bonus funds and winnings are released.

Comparing the full terms is more valuable than choosing the largest advertised figure. A smaller promotion with realistic conditions may provide greater flexibility than a substantial package carrying strict limits.

Deposits, Withdrawals, and Account Protection

Payment choice affects both convenience and processing speed. Cards, bank transfers, and selected digital wallets may be available, although minimum limits, fees, and verification requirements can differ. Before making a deposit, confirm that the chosen method also supports withdrawals where possible.

Identity checks are a standard part of regulated gambling. The operator may request proof of identity, address, or payment ownership. Supplying accurate details during registration can prevent avoidable delays. Players should never share passwords, one-time codes, or banking credentials with another person, and two-factor authentication should be enabled whenever it is offered.
